Angular speed of second's hand

ω= 2π/  revolution time(in sec)  

​ Revolution time of second's hand =1rev/min=1rev/60sec

⇒ ω=  2π/60sec

​ So the speed of tip of the hand is given by

⇒v=rω=2cm× 2π/60sec  ≃ 0.21cm/sec
